Design, develop, and execute comprehensive end-to-end test strategies and automated test scripts to validate software functionality and quality, primarily within Cards Issuing, Payments, or Banking domains.
Collaborate closely with cross-functional teams including business, development, infrastructure, and vendors to analyse requirements, define acceptance criteria, perform defect root cause analysis, and coordinate SIT, E2E, UAT, and production proving activities.
Lead and supervise team members, guide professional development, allocate resources, and promote continuous improvement of testing processes and methodologies, ensuring risk mitigation and compliance with policies.
Strong experience in end-to-end testing with focus on Cards Issuing, Payments, or Banking domains involving complex integrated systems.
Hands-on expertise with test automation frameworks and tools such as Selenium, Playwright, Cypress, or Rest Assured.
Proven ability in test planning, design, execution, defect management, and coordination of SIT, E2E, UAT, and production proving testing activities.
Work Experience Required: Not explicitly mentioned in the JD; Location Requirement: Pune based role.
Experienced in validating complex business processes across multiple integrated systems within payment or banking technology stacks.
Established capability to lead test teams, influence stakeholders across business and technical areas, and manage risk and control in testing processes.
Familiar with Agile methodologies, CI/CD pipelines, DevOps practices, and modern test automation including AI-assisted and self-healing automation techniques.
